The new trailer for 'The Woman in Black' reveals more spooky and unnerving scenes including a faint silhouette of a shadowy lady who's haunting the Eel Marsh house.
A new trailer for Daniel Radcliffe-starring movie "The Woman in Black" has been released, giving more sneak peek at the vengeful ghost of a scorned woman in Eel Marsh house. In one of the never-before-seen footage, a dark shadow is seen appearing in the hallway of the haunted mansion, prompting the Arthur Kipps depicter to shout, "Who's there?"

The film follows a London lawyer who's summoned into a small village in order to settle paper work for the deceased owner of the haunted house. Entering the house without knowing the danger inside, he faces a life threatening vengeance from the spirits of a woman. Instead of cowering and running like the others suggest him to do, he's determined to uncover the identity of the angry specter.

Based on Susan Hill's novel of the same name, the horror flick directed by James Watkins is set to hit theaters in the United States on February 3, 2012. Joining Radcliffe in the upcoming movie are the likes of Ciaran Hinds as Daily, Liz White as Jennet, Janet McTeer as Mrs. Daily, and Alisa Khazanova as Alice Drablow.
